Coca-Cola Creates Buzz With Drone Delivery of Coke-coffee Crossover

AMI Advance Manufacturing International, Inc. company logo

Coca-Cola has teamed up with Walmart and drone flight services provider DroneUp to deliver its new Coca-Cola with Coffee and its zero-sugar variant to customers in Coffee County, Georgia. As part of a launch stunt, select customers who live in single-family residences within a one-mile radius of Coffee County’s Walmart Supercenter could have their coke-coffee fix delivered via drone. According to the enthusiasts at DroneDJ, the drone appeared to be a customized DJI Matrice 600 Pro with four arms to hold the package during flight and a tether system to lower the product at the drop-off location. This enabled the drone operators to avoid any risk of the drone coming into contact with people on the ground. Coca-Cola with Coffee and its zero-sugar option are infused with Brazilian coffee and come in a variety of flavors. Coca-Cola with Coffee is available in Dark Blend, Vanilla, and Caramel, while its zero-sugar counterpart comes in Dark Blend and Vanilla. Each 12-oz. can contains 69 mg of caffeine. A 12-oz. can of standard Coke contains 34 mg, Diet Coke contains 46 mg, while the same-sized coffee has 140 mg or more.
